早告诉你了吧
A place to tell the truth, the whole truth and nothing but the truth.
计算机网络实验作业windows下网络命令的理解:netsh, arp, nslookup 计算机网络实验作业windows下网络命令的理解:netsh, arp, nslookup
一、【实验目的】 学会使用netsh命令测试本机的TCP/IP网络配置 学会使用netstat命令以及检测网络连接 了解ARP原理以及使用ARP探索攻击源头 了解nslookup命令的用法 二、【实验环境】Windows command prompt or powershell 三、【实验要求】netsh使用netsh命令查看本机的IP地址,并修改本机的静态或者动态IP地址并截图显示 然后就
2019-01-25
计算机网络作业之常用命令ping, tracert, ipconfig, nbtstat, route和arp 计算机网络作业之常用命令ping, tracert, ipconfig, nbtstat, route和arp
1. PingPing其他主机 Ping自己IP Ping localhost Ping -t 命令不间断发送数据包 Ping -n [数字]命令:发送[数字]个数据包 Ping -l [数字]命令:定义数据包的大小   2. Tracert使用TRACERT (跟踪路径) 命令是一个路由跟踪实用程序,用于确定采取的 IP 数据包到达目标的路径。 普通用法 Tracert localhost 使
2019-01-25
网络工程课程实践实验之利用pcattcp分析TCP协议 网络工程课程实践实验之利用pcattcp分析TCP协议
PCATTCP介绍PCATTCP的前身为Test TCP,Test TCP是BSD操作系统的原生工具,该工具通过控制台输入参数,用于测试TCP或者UDP的通信速度。该项目于1984年启动,现在该工具的源代码早已开放。PCATTCP是Test TCP的windows移植版本,是一个用于测试TCP和UDP通信速度的windows控制台程序。 如果你是windows用户的话,你可以点击这里下载PCATT
2018-11-03
网络工程课程实践实验之利用WireShark分析IP协议 网络工程课程实践实验之利用WireShark分析IP协议
1. IP协议简述TCP/IP协议定义了一个在局域网上传输的包,称为IP数据报(IP Datagram)。IP数据报由首部和数据两部分组成,首部部分包括版本,长度,IP地址等信息。数据部分一般用来传输其他的协议,如TCP,UDP和ICMP协议等。 控制消息是指网络通不通、主机是否可达、路由是否可用等网络本身的消息。这些控制消息虽然并不传输用户数据,但是对于用户数据的传递起着重要的作用。 2. 分析
2018-11-02
网络工程课程实践实验之观察一个轻量级网络 网络工程课程实践实验之观察一个轻量级网络
1. 打开wiresharkWireshark(前称Ethereal)是一个免费开源的网络数据包分析软件。网络数据包分析软件的功能是截取网络数据包,并尽可能显示出最为详细的网络数据包数据。 你可以在这里https://www.wireshark.org/download.html下载到最新版本的wireshark 选择一个目前正在活动的网络,双击进行抓取 2. 打开浏览器访问一个网站 3. 使用
2018-11-01
如何给腾讯云服务器的域名配置SSL证书,给自己的网站上https 如何给腾讯云服务器的域名配置SSL证书,给自己的网站上https
1. 写在前面的话域名和服务器都是在腾讯云上面的,本文将实现做新的域名解析,API部署,nignx反向代理配置,申请SSL证书,部署证书等流程 2. 新的子域名解析在腾讯云的域名服务中添加一条A记录将api.blog.tellyouwhat.cn解析到118.89.167.182这台服务器上 3. API部署打包API执行Gradle build命令,开始打包 使用xftp连接到服务器在当前u
2018-04-24
如何使用python做syn_flood攻击的实验 如何使用python做syn_flood攻击的实验
什么是SYN_FLOOD若正常通过三次握手过程,则连接就建立了,但是恶意攻击者会刻意伪造ip地址,使得受攻击的主机得不到最后一次握手,只能不断的为到来的syn分配内存,发送syn+ack,就这样一直等不到第三次握手的ack确认。 同时开启多个线程运行即可达到攻击效果 结果任务管理器展示CPU使用率 该网段已无法访问 代码from Tools.scripts.treesync import raw_
2018-04-11
如何使用Java手写实现一个RSA加密算法 如何使用Java手写实现一个RSA加密算法
8到16位RSA实现RSA这种算法非常可靠,密钥越长,它就越难破解。 第一步,随机选择两个不相等的质数p和q。 第二步,计算p和q的乘积n。 第三步,计算n的欧拉函数φ(n)。 第四步,随机选择一个整数e,条件是1< e < φ(n),且e与φ(n) 互质。 第五步,计算e对于φ(n)的模反元素d。 第六步,将n和e封装成公钥,n和d封装成私钥。 实现效果 代码密钥的父类: pub
2018-03-27
如何使用Java优雅的破解维吉尼亚密码 如何使用Java优雅的破解维吉尼亚密码
对包括维吉尼亚密码在内的所有多表密码的破译都是以字母频率为基础的,但直接的频率分析却并不适用。例如,如果P是密文中出现次数最多的字母,则P很有可能对应E(前提是明文的语言为英语)。原因在于E是英语中使用频率最高的字母。然而,由于在维吉尼亚密码中,E可以被加密成不同的密文,因而简单的频率分析在这里并没有用。破译维吉尼亚密码的关键在于它的密钥是循环重复的。如果我们知道了密钥的长度,那密文就可以被看作是
2018-03-17
Windows下常用的网络配置命令浅析 Windows下常用的网络配置命令浅析
原文章发表在 简书:https://www.jianshu.com/p/23e52ad9c44c 现在有了自己的静态博客,特意搬过来 一、学习目的 学会使用netsh命令测试本机的TCP/IP网络配置 学会使用netstat命令以及检测网络连接 了解arp原理以及使用arp探索攻击源头 了解nslookup命令的用法 二、学习要求使用netsh命令查看本机的IP地址,并修改本机的静态或者动态
2017-11-09